West Palm Beach, FL (PRWEB) February 26, 2006 -- Today the Imperiali Organization announced that it will be sending its Chairman, Daniel Imperato, who has 30 years of experience in the region, to the Asia Pacific region to develop strategic partners, meet with equity investors, and explore joint venture and acquisition opportunities.

With plans to expand its business portal, Imperato has begun to further strengthen his existing global relations, on behalf of the Imperiali Organization, in addition to starting new ones.

The Imperiali Organization has rapidly increased its existing presence around the world with recent strategic relations coming from London, South Africa, and the Middle East.

“Our mission is to be the fastest gateway to the globe,” commented Imperato. “In order to do that, you have to make sure that all the doors are open, and made accessible for all. With the help and support of our international partners, we are looking to make our organization a success as well as the companies that we advise,” explained Imperato.

The planned business tour looks to take the Imperiali Organization to Singapore, Hong Kong, China, and Japan.

“The opportunity for growth and expansion in the Asia Pacific region is great. There are many strategic partners who could greatly add to the Imperiali Organization as advisors as well as there are many partners who could add to Imperiali Organization’s portfolio of projects,” stated Imperato.

Imperato, Imperiali Organization’s founder, has been able to utilize his experience and knowledge of the region’s culture in order to foster and develop relations. His wisdom and cultural expertise have proven to be invaluable commodities for the expansion of the Imperiali Organization.

“The first thing that I recognize when doing business with people from around the world is respect. I respect their culture, their tradition, their family, their country, and their way of life. I believe in doing business with confidence, and mutual beneficial respect. Across the Asia Pacific region, particularly Singapore, Hong Kong, China, and Japan, the people espouse those same principles and with confidence and mutual beneficial respect, the Imperiali Organization can do great things with our Asia Pacific partners,” asserted Imperato.

Currently the Imperiali Organization maintains relations in over 70 countries around the world, and has developed projects in many fields including public relations, publishing, sports & entertainment, and technology.
